Building in Tufton Street
Description
Front elevation of 53 Tufton Street, Westminster, a three-storey brick building with shop at ground-floor level. Originally built by Sir Richard Tufton in the seventeenth century, Tufton Street was significantly redeveloped in the early-twentieth century. Number 53 stands alone, adjacent buildings having already been demolished and their sites fenced in. The structure of 53 is stabilised by wooden props to side and front elevations. Two windows are bricked up and a man watches from an open sash window. The shop is closed and shuttered with a fly poster for Herring Son & Daw, estate agents, and numerous adverts for Lipton's Tea. "Lot 2" is painted on the front wall of the house possibly indicating sale of shop contents. A second man leans on the nearby fence watching the photographer. Graffiti covers the other section of fence, mainly illegible, with three chalk profile portraits of men. 53 Tufton Street is no longer extant and was replaced in the 1930s by Tufton Court, a seven-storey mansion block. The east side of the street lies within the Smith Square conservation area designated in 1969.
